Square #13
Note:
fptr front post treble crochet Yo two times, insert hook from front to back to front around stitch indicated, pull up lp, (yo, pull through 2 lps on hook) 3 times.

Row 1:
Ch 32, sc in second ch from hook, * skip next 2 ch, 5 dc in next ch--shell made, skip next 2 ch, sc in next ch, dc in next 4 ch, ch 1, skip next ch, sc in next ch **; repeat from * across ending last repeat at **.

Row 2: Ch 5 (counts as dc and ch 2), sc in center dc of first shell, ch 2, dc in next sc, (ch 1, bpdc around next 4 dc, dc in next sc, ch 2, sc in center dc of next shell, ch 2, dc in next sc) across, turn.

Row 3: Ch 1, sc in first dc, *shell in next sc, sc in next dc **, skip next 2 dc, fptr in next 2 dc, fptr in two skipped dc, ch 1, sc in next dc; repeat from * across ending last repeat at **, turn.

Row 4: Ch 5 (counts as dc and ch 2), sc in center dc of first shell, ch 2, dc in next sc, (ch 1, bpdc around next 4 tr, dc in next sc, ch 2, sc in center dc of next shell, ch 2, dc in next sc) across, turn.

Row 5: Ch 1, sc in first dc, shell in next sc, sc in next dc, (fpdc around next 4 dc, ch 1, sc in next dc, shell in next sc, sc in next dc) across, turn.

Row 6-8: Repeat rows 2-4.

Rows 9-16 or until piece is square, or almost square: Repeat rows 5-8.

At end of last row, fasten off.

To make this stitch pattern any size, begin with ch multiple of 6 plus 2.
